You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@netbeans.apache.org by jt...@apache.org on 2019/05/05 03:35:31 UTC

[netbeans-html4j] branch master updated: Avoid JavaFX framework shutdown between tests

This is an automated email from the ASF dual-hosted git repository.

jtulach pushed a commit to branch master
in repository https://gitbox.apache.org/repos/asf/netbeans-html4j.git


The following commit(s) were added to refs/heads/master by this push:
     new 52f8f6c  Avoid JavaFX framework shutdown between tests
52f8f6c is described below

commit 52f8f6c6e61bb6f746d0b95f65e0c564c4e8bf0b
Author: Jaroslav Tulach <ja...@apidesign.org>
AuthorDate: Sun May 5 05:35:13 2019 +0200

    Avoid JavaFX framework shutdown between tests
---
 ko4j/src/test/java/org/netbeans/html/ko4j/InitializeKnockoutTest.java | 1 +
 ko4j/src/test/java/org/netbeans/html/ko4j/KnockoutFXTest.java         | 2 ++
 2 files changed, 3 insertions(+)

diff --git a/ko4j/src/test/java/org/netbeans/html/ko4j/InitializeKnockoutTest.java b/ko4j/src/test/java/org/netbeans/html/ko4j/InitializeKnockoutTest.java
index 3ae5a3b..08c374b 100644
--- a/ko4j/src/test/java/org/netbeans/html/ko4j/InitializeKnockoutTest.java
+++ b/ko4j/src/test/java/org/netbeans/html/ko4j/InitializeKnockoutTest.java
@@ -45,6 +45,7 @@ public class InitializeKnockoutTest {
     
     @BeforeClass
     public void initFX() throws Throwable {
+        Platform.setImplicitExit(false);
         new Thread("initFX") {
             @Override
             public void run() {
diff --git a/ko4j/src/test/java/org/netbeans/html/ko4j/KnockoutFXTest.java b/ko4j/src/test/java/org/netbeans/html/ko4j/KnockoutFXTest.java
index 8bde691..93979b7 100644
--- a/ko4j/src/test/java/org/netbeans/html/ko4j/KnockoutFXTest.java
+++ b/ko4j/src/test/java/org/netbeans/html/ko4j/KnockoutFXTest.java
@@ -31,6 +31,7 @@ import java.util.List;
 import java.util.Map;
 import java.util.concurrent.Executor;
 import java.util.concurrent.Executors;
+import javafx.application.Platform;
 import net.java.html.BrwsrCtx;
 import net.java.html.boot.BrowserBuilder;
 import net.java.html.js.JavaScriptBody;
@@ -71,6 +72,7 @@ public final class KnockoutFXTest extends KnockoutTCK {
         
         URI uri = DynamicHTTP.initServer();
     
+        Platform.setImplicitExit(false);
         final BrowserBuilder bb = BrowserBuilder.newBrowser(new FXGCPresenter()).loadClass(KnockoutFXTest.class).
             loadPage(uri.toString()).
             invoke("initialized");


---------------------------------------------------------------------
To unsubscribe, e-mail: commits-unsubscribe@netbeans.apache.org
For additional commands, e-mail: commits-help@netbeans.apache.org

For further information about the NetBeans mailing lists, visit:
https://cwiki.apache.org/confluence/display/NETBEANS/Mailing+lists